Elementary Schooling Norms & Entitlements: In accordance with national Samagra Shiksha norms, free elementary schooling is provided within walking distance. Students enrolled in government schools receive free school bags, uniforms, textbooks, and fresh hot-cooked nutritional meals daily under the PM POSHAN program.
RTE 25% Free Admission Quota: Under Section 12(1)(c) of the Right of Children to Free and Compulsory Education Act, private unaided schools in and around Pachim-Sulgiri are legally required to admit a minimum of 25% students from weaker sections and disadvantaged groups into entry-level classes completely tuition-free.
